Here is an interesting rock mystery. Who is Jandek? Nobody really knows for sure. Some say he a musician living in the Houston area. Some say Jandek is a group that keeps its secrets well kind of like the Residents (in fact the mystery is a lot like the Residents and the early days of Ralph Records).
